eNotes: Liability – February 2025 – Pennsylvania
SIGNIFICANT CASE SUMMARIES Pennsylvania Case Summaries Bazzano v. Spade Pennsylvania Superior Court No. 99 WDA 2024 Decided: December 23, 2024 Trial Court did not err when it ruled that a guilty plea for criminal charges from the subject accident and two prior DUIs were inadmissible.
